An Energy Management System Approach for Power System Cyber-Physical Resilience

arXiv:2110.03451

Abstract

Power systems are large scale cyber-physical critical infrastructure that form the basis of modern society. The reliability and resilience of the grid is dependent on the correct functioning of related subsystems, including computing, communications, and control. The integration is widespread and has a profound impact on the operation, reliability, and efficiency of the grid. Technologies comprising these infrastructure can expose new sources of threats. Mapping these threats to their grid resilience impacts to stop them early requires a timely and detailed view of the entire cyber-physical system. Grid resilience must therefore be seen and addressed as a cyber-physical systems problem. This short position paper presents several key preliminaries, supported with evidence from experience, to enable cyber-physical situational awareness and intrusion response through a cyber-physical energy management system.
